We partner with local vendors that rent these. We get a referral fee for anyone that rents from them. They mention our name for a small discount and we collect our referral fee. We do it with slingshots, jetskis, bikes, golf carts, etc. We have a placard in the home with the company and the toys they rent.

My cleaning costs were 10% of a typical 3-night booking (my minimum) but now they are 5% since I doubled my rates. Less if they book for longer than 3 nights.

I find it more effective to go directly to AirBnB and VRBO and search for similar homes in the area I am researching. Being able to see their pricing and occupancy along with the product they are selling is more "apples to apples" and gives me an idea of what I have to do to compete.
